Operated Hire:
Hire any machine with an experienced RW Groundworks operator. The operator arrives with the machine, works to your direction, and takes the machine away at the end of the day. This is the right option if you don't hold the relevant CPCS tickets, or if you want someone who knows the machine inside out running it on your site.
Operated hire rates include the machine and the operator. Fuel is charged at cost.
Self-Drive Hire:
If you hold the relevant CPCS or NPORS tickets, you can hire any machine on a self-drive basis. Machines are delivered to site and collected at the end of the hire period. A brief handover covers the controls and any machine-specific features.
Valid tickets must be presented before the machine is released. Insurance cover must be confirmed — either your own plant insurance or cover arranged through RW Groundworks.

RW Groundworks delivers plant across Cornwall. Machines are transported on our low-loader and delivered to site at the agreed time. Delivery costs depend on distance from Helston — call for a quote. For multi-day hires, the machine stays on site and delivery/collection is charged once.

For self-drive hire, you need a valid CPCS (Construction Plant Competence Scheme) or NPORS card for the machine category. For operated hire, no — our experienced operator runs the machine on your behalf. If you don't hold the right tickets, operated hire is the straightforward option.
Operated hire means the machine comes with a qualified operator from RW Groundworks. The operator drives the machine, works to your direction on site, and handles all aspects of machine operation. You get the machine and the expertise. This is the standard choice for customers who don't operate plant regularly.
For most domestic jobs — driveways, landscaping, drainage, small foundations — a 3-tonne mini excavator is the right choice. For new builds, large excavations, demolition, and road construction, the 14-tonne excavator is needed. Dumpers are sized to match — a 7-tonne dumper pairs well with the 14-tonne excavator. Delivery costs depend on distance from our Helston base. Within the Helston and Penwith area, delivery is typically included or charged at a flat rate. Wider Cornwall deliveries are quoted individually. For multi-day hires, delivery and collection are charged once regardless of hire duration.
A deposit may be required for self-drive hire, refundable on return of the machine in good condition. The deposit amount depends on the machine hired. Operated hire does not require a deposit — invoiced on standard terms on completion of the hire period.
A micro digger weighs under 1 tonne and fits through standard doorways — used for indoor work, very tight access, and small garden jobs. A mini digger (like our 3.3T Hitachi) weighs 1 to 6 tonnes and handles most domestic and light commercial excavation. For anything beyond foundations and drainage on a single property, you'll typically need a mini digger at minimum. RW Groundworks can advise on which size suits your project.
Our 3.3-tonne Hitachi is approximately 1.5 metres wide, which fits through most side access gates. Standard garden gates are typically 0.9m to 1.2m wide — too narrow for tracked machines. If side access is tight, we can sometimes track across a front garden or use a smaller attachment.
